E28F004BVB80 non-volatile flash memory chip 4Mbit CUI 80 ns
E28F004BVB80 is an obsolete Intel SmartVoltage boot block non-volatile flash memory chip with total 4-Mbit storage capacity, configurable as 512K×8 byte-wide mode or 256K×16 word-wide mode via the BYTE# control pin. The memory array adopts a segmented boot block layout optimized for embedded boot firmware storage, containing one hardware-lockable 16KB bottom boot block for core startup code protection against accidental erasure, two independent 8KB parameter blocks for frequently updated configuration data to replace discrete EEPROM chips, plus three large main data blocks (one 96KB, three 128KB) for storing application firmware, diagnostic logs and permanent device calibration values, with independent block erase functionality to avoid full-chip data loss during partial content rewriting.
Integrated hardware protection circuits including VPP lockout, RP reset and WP write-protect pins safeguard critical boot code, while low-power standby and deep power-down modes cut static current draw for battery-powered embedded hardware; it supports standard JEDEC flash command set for unified read, program, erase and status register polling, delivering reliable 100,000 block erase cycles and 20-year minimum data retention without external power supply.It widely deployed in legacy industrial controllers, vintage desktop/laptop PC BIOS motherboards, network router boot firmware modules, medical diagnostic equipment and automotive embedded ECU systems.
Alternative Flash Models
● TE28F004BVB80: Intel pin-compatible tray-packaged variant of E28F004BVB80 with identical 4Mbit boot block architecture, 80ns access time and dual voltage operation, designed for automated tray assembly of legacy motherboard repair batches.
● E28F400BVB80: Intel 4Mbit top-boot-block flash with identical electrical specs and speed, only differing in boot block address position for microcontrollers requiring high-address startup code storage.
● MX29F400TC-80G: Macronix mainstream parallel boot flash with 4Mbit density, 80ns access speed and 40-TSOP packaging, supporting single 3.3V operation as modern low-voltage substitute for old 5V Intel flash chips.
● SST39SF040-90-4C-NH: SST low-cost 4Mbit parallel flash with uniform sector erase and single 3.3V power supply, ideal simplified alternative for non-critical embedded firmware storage without dedicated hardware boot lock functions.
